I ordered all these juices on the June 30th received them july 1st
Heard lots of good things about mtbakervapor so i decided to try a few juices from them. there prices are very good and shipping was extremely quick. Mtbakervapor claims there juices are made to order and may require steeping. I have never had much luck with steeping and the flavor has never gotten any better or worse from steeping in my experience. So needless to say I don't consider steeping when taste testing. However these juices have been sitting for about 4 days before i tried them.
all juices i ordered were 50/50 vg/pg blend @ 12mg with 1 additional flavor shot. vaped all these juices on a RBA at 1.7ohms, and cleaned and dried thoroughly after each juice testing
Juices ordered: Butterscotch Tobacco, Cinnamon Roll, Butter Toffee. They did send me a free sample of Hawk Sauce 30ml 18mg 80/20 pg/vg. I thought that was very nice of them and really appreciated it.
Butterscotch Tobacco:
I ordered this juice because I do like RY4 so I thought maybe this could be a nice juice. The juice is really dark rendering it a coil killer for sure. The vapor is on par with a 50/50 blend but the throat hit is very mild at any voltage or wattage i set it at. The tobacco flavor in this juice was very artificial and tasted perfumey and chemically. I have never had a tobacco flavor taste perfumey but some how this flavor managed to. It may have been the butterscotch flavor mixing with the tobacco flavor causing this taste. However the butterscotch flavor is very hard to pick out. Its very very mild so i cant really comment on the butterscotch because there wasn't enough in the juice for me to break it down and try to describe it. The tobacco is a sweeter tobacco almost like a pipe tobacco even.

Cinnamon Roll:
This juice was a light orange when i got it but has turned a shade darker over the last few days. The vapor production on this juice is great and on par with a 50/50 blend and throat hit is good but maybe on par with a 9 or 10mg not quite a 12mg. This juice does give you that very nice pastry flavor of a cinnamon roll, mixed with a nice cinnamon note. I don't taste much of the icing flavor in there but it is there. Its a rather sweet vape so I couldn't all day vape it. The cinnamon does bother my taste buds after awhile of vaping it so i have to put it down and move to something else. I find that if i vape it over and over again the flavor seems to lose its luster, and that's prob the cinnamon flavor doing that. Is it the best cinnamon roll vape i ever had?? umm No its not but its definitely up there in the top 5 prob at 4.

Hawk Sauce:
This was the juice given to me for free as a sample. The vapor is good and on par with a 50/50 blend. The throat hit is extremely light. Before i mention the flavor let me say this, it came with two additional flavor shots. I think this juice may have just way too much flavor in it. When i open the bottle it smells amazing like a sour key candy. The flavor is very different from the smell in this circumstance. I don't know whats in it and I cant even tell you because there website doesn't even describe what flavors are in it but i can say it does have fruity tones to it. It also has a sour tartness to it but I feel like its a menthol vape. it has this weird cooling effect in the pallet if that makes sense. It also has a really strong chemical taste to it, also on the perfumy side as well. I think its really overwhelming and rendered unvapeable for me. It might be because it has 2 additional flavor shots in it. Maybe if it had the normal amount of flavor i would like it? I don't know but this is how I got it so this is how I am going to review it.
